Samenvatting:
"This companion book to Building to Impact (BtI) is about stopping, reducing, and/or reversing the initiatives and programs we implement in schools. The authors expand the three-page discussion in BtI into a more comprehensive de-implementation process that they call Making Room for Impact. This is the first book-length de-implementation model in education or healthcare that provides a detailed and rigorous framework, and one that is designed for use at all levels of the system. The 9Ps are DISCOVER: Permit, Prospect, Postulate; DECIDE: Propose, Prepare, Picture; DE-IMPLEMENT: Proceed; RE-DECIDE: Praise, Propel. There are five reasons that educators might seek to get serious, rigorous, explicit, and focused about stopping and de-implementing: 1. To substitute less-effective practices for those that have more evidence and probability for impact 2. To substitute more expensive interventions with those that have the same or better outcomes at a fraction of the cost 3. To adapt practices that have become over-engineered 4. To dial-down the use of a still-needed process 5. To get our lives back"--
